Registered Nursing at Holmes Community College

What traits are you looking for in a school for Registered Nursing, you may want to check out the program at Holmes Community College. We’ve gathered the following information to help you decide.

Holmes Community College is in Goodman, MS.

In the most recent year for which we have data, 129 registered nursing degrees were granted at Holmes Community College.

Studying Online at Holmes Community College

Online coursework is an option at Holmes Community College. Of 5,039 students, 1,608 (32%) studied exclusively online and 1,164 (23%) took at least some classes online.

Student Demographics & Diversity

The following sections describe the composition of Registered Nursing graduates at Holmes Community College, broken down by degree level.

Across all degree levels, Registered Nursing graduates at Holmes Community College are 90% women (116) and 10% men (13).

Registered Nursing Associate’s Program at Holmes Community College

Of the 129 associate’s registered nursing graduates at Holmes Community College, 90% were women (116) and 10% were men (13).

Holmes Community College gender breakdown of Registered Nursing Associate's degree recipients

The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ity of Registered Nursing associate’s degree recipients at Holmes Community College.

Race / Ethnicity Number of Graduates
White 66
Black / African American 61
American Indian / Alaska Native 1
Two or More Races 1
Racial-ethnic diversity of Registered Nursing majors at Holmes Community College

Racial-ethnic minorities make up 49% of Registered Nursing associate’s degree recipients at Holmes Community College, above the national average of 43%.*

*The racial-ethnic minorities figure is the total number of graduates minus White, international (nonresident), and unknown-race graduates.
